teljari
Icelandic
Etymology
From telja (“to count”) + -ari (“-er, suffix used to create agent nouns from verbs”).
Noun
teljari m (genitive singular teljara, nominative plural teljarar)
- (arithmetic) a numerator
- an enumerator, a counter, a machine or a human that counts
Derived terms
- hlutteljari (partial numerator)
